Transaction 81e5ffc9ea5db2cc4be6258fe88d0398038e90d87a1b796424f690b3f3be8e23

1 Input
2 Outputs
  • 81e5ffc9ea5db2cc4be6258fe88d0398038e90d87a1b796424f690b3f3be8e23:0
  • value  548595
    address  3KpNaPcxKN5BH3eWZHty9dTwwSRRTx1s57
  • 81e5ffc9ea5db2cc4be6258fe88d0398038e90d87a1b796424f690b3f3be8e23:1
  • value  4196301
    address  1MhmF9KUcr8YEnuApz5rT8dMNCeaHUwmt2